Learning the bash Shell, 2nd Edition

Learning the bash Shell, 2nd Edition pdf epub mobi txt 电子书 下载 2026

出版者:O'Reilly Media
作者:Cameron Newham
出品人:
页数:336
译者:
出版时间:1998-1-23
价格:USD 29.95
装帧:Paperback
isbn号码:9781565923478
丛书系列:
图书标签:
  • Shell
  • 编程
  • shell
  • Linux
  • bash
  • O'Reilly
  • unix
  • programming
  • bash
  • shell
  • linux
  • commandline
  • unix
  • programming
  • sysadmin
  • automation
  • scripting
  • terminal
想要找书就要到 小哈图书下载中心
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

作者简介

目录信息

读后感

评分

行文很生硬,很多地方甚至连基本的文法句法都不通——可以通过提取主干主谓宾来验证。 如果不是同时在看另外一本讲Shell的书,仅仅是通过这本来了解Shell的话,我很可能就悲剧了,这本书糟糕的翻译会让我我误以为Shell本身是一门艰深的技术,从而一直止步于门外。这也是所有同...  

评分

应该说,bash这类shell脚本的学习书籍,涉及的内容会比较杂,很高兴作者把这些杂乱的内容有序的组织到这本书里。 应该说,这本书读起来应该不会很吃力,因为对bash的介绍很多也就是对linux操作系统,特别是和shell相关部分的介绍,而且很多人对linux/unix的最直观和直接的操...  

评分

确实是Learning系列的书,所以非常的浅显易懂。 适合没有什么Shell实用经验的人。 可以很快对Bash有一个整体的概念,并且能够做一些简单的工作。 看完了书,还需要很多的实际解决问题的经验才行。  

评分

看完这本书,可是里面的题目有些不会^^^^^,后面几章的课后习题没有解答,对我这种菜鸟有点难度啊…… 深入的学习shell script,看什么?? ABS吗?  

评分

这不是我想要的Shell入门,因为它没有让我感受到一丝Shell的魅力,通篇只有细节,而且讲述不清(比如对getopts里OPTARG(在bash 3.2里好像是OPTSTRING)的讲解,让我一度很困惑,这个序列存的参数到底是以词为单位呢,还是字符),缺乏比较(比如文中似乎没有关于$(()), $[], [],...

用户评价

评分

这本书的价值,远超乎它作为一本“工具书”的范畴,它更像是一份关于“计算思维”的入门指南。它不仅仅教授了特定的命令语法,更重要的是,它在潜移默化中训练了读者的逻辑分解能力。例如,在讲解如何编写一个备份脚本时,书中不仅提供了脚本本身,还详细讨论了备份策略的选择、权限的设置、日志记录的重要性以及错误恢复机制的设计。这种全面的、系统化的思考方式,是很多只关注语法层面的书籍所不具备的。它让我明白了,编写一个可靠的Shell脚本,和设计一个稳定运行的程序一样,需要考虑健壮性、可读性和可维护性。对于任何想要真正理解现代操作系统底层运作机制的人来说,这本书提供了一个无可替代的视角。它让你从一个被动的用户,转变为一个能主动构建和优化工作流程的系统架构师,这种能力的提升是立竿见影且影响深远的。

评分

从排版和内容组织的角度来看,这本书的编排简直是教科书级别的典范,体现了对读者学习体验的极致关怀。很多技术书籍堆砌了大量信息,但结构混乱,让人找不到重点。但此书的结构设计非常合理,循序渐进,保证了初学者不会因为信息过载而气馁,同时资深用户也能快速定位到自己需要的进阶内容。每一个新概念的引入,都伴随着精心设计的代码示例,这些示例不是那种为了演示功能而存在的“玩具代码”,而是高度仿真的、可以直接拿来修改和应用的真实场景片段。更值得称赞的是,作者在讲解每个命令的参数和选项时,没有简单地罗列man页的内容,而是深入剖析了不同参数组合带来的实际效果差异,这对于形成肌肉记忆和直觉判断至关重要。我特别欣赏它对文本流处理工具集(如`cut`, `sort`, `uniq`)的系统性梳理,让你能清晰地看到 Unix 哲学中“小工具组合解决大问题”的精髓,这是一种对效率和简洁性的终极追求。

评分

这本操作系统命令行工具的使用指南,简直是技术人员的“救星”!我本来对Linux系统的文件操作和脚本编写感到头疼不已,感觉自己就像一个迷失在代码丛林里的新手。然而,自从我接触了这本书,那种无力感就烟消云散了。它不是那种枯燥乏味的字典式手册,而是以一种非常贴近实际工作场景的方式,一步步引导你掌握那些看似复杂的命令。比如说,书里对管道(Pipes)和重定向(Redirections)的讲解,简直是神来之笔,清晰到让人恍然大悟,原来这些强大的工具可以如此优雅地组合起来解决实际问题。我记得有一次,我需要从一个包含数百万行日志的文件中筛选出特定时间段的错误记录,并且把结果导出到一个新的文件中进行分析。我过去可能需要写一个冗长且效率低下的脚本,但读完书中关于`grep`、`awk`和`sed`的章节后,我只用了一个简洁的单行命令就完成了任务,效率提升了好几倍。这种从“知道命令”到“精通使用”的转变,完全得益于作者详尽且充满实战经验的叙述方式。它不仅仅是教你“怎么做”,更深层次地解释了“为什么这么做”,培养了读者真正的系统思维。

评分

我不得不说,这本书在系统管理和自动化方面的深度挖掘,彻底颠覆了我对命令行操作的认知。以往我对Shell脚本的印象还停留在简单的循环和变量赋值,总觉得它不够“专业”。但这本书中的高级主题,例如函数库的构建、信号处理机制(Signal Handling)的讲解,以及如何编写健壮的、能够优雅处理错误的脚本,实在是太精彩了。它成功地将原本晦涩难懂的底层机制,用生动的比喻和清晰的架构图展现出来,让复杂的流程变得一目了然。特别是关于进程管理和作业控制的部分,让我明白了如何在多任务环境下高效地调度和监控程序。举个例子,书中探讨了如何使用`trap`命令来确保在脚本退出时,无论正常与否,都能执行清理操作,这对于维护服务器的稳定运行至关重要。这已经超出了普通用户的使用范畴,直接触及到了系统运维的核心技能。读完这些部分,我感觉自己不再是简单地执行命令,而是真正开始“掌控”操作系统的工作流了。

评分

我是一个偏爱图形界面的用户,但工作要求我必须处理大量的远程服务器任务,这让我对Shell脚本产生了深深的抵触情绪。这本书奇迹般地改变了我的态度,它的叙述语言非常具有说服力,让你不得不承认,在某些特定的、需要高频次重复执行的任务面前,命令行工具的效率是GUI无法比拟的。作者在介绍正则表达式(Regex)的部分,尤其让人印象深刻。他们没有把它讲成一个独立的、令人望而生畏的知识点,而是巧妙地将其融入到`sed`和`awk`的讲解中,展示了如何用这种强大的文本匹配语言来精确地定位和修改数据。通过大量的“动手实践”环节的引导,我开始享受那种通过键盘输入快速实现复杂数据转换的成就感。这种从抗拒到接受,乃至最终热衷的过程,完全得益于作者将抽象概念具体化、将枯燥语法趣味化的叙事能力。它成功地将一个工具的使用,升华为一种解决问题的艺术。

评分

被逼无奈阿,随让我得瑟呢

评分

被逼无奈阿,随让我得瑟呢

评分

被逼无奈阿,随让我得瑟呢

评分

被逼无奈阿,随让我得瑟呢

评分

被逼无奈阿,随让我得瑟呢

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 qciss.net All Rights Reserved. 小哈图书下载中心 版权所有